Episode thumbnail for Season 2, Episode #12 - Technology, Systems & Tools

December 3, 2025

Season 2, Episode #12 - Technology, Systems & Tools

Chapter 20 of Accelerating Revenue concludes our deep dive series by addressing ever present “tech stack” questions. In this episode, our Notebook LM hosts “Lucas & Maren” cover how to think about the GTM tech stack and Enablement’s role in guiding the curation of it. We touch on everything from thinking strategically, assessing tech and tool needs, where to focus, what to invest in, how to ensure the tools are utilized, and the potential drawbacks of over-investment. We close out by addressing tech stack audits and fit assessments to ensure the tech stack is maintained over time.

Episode thumbnail for Season 2, Episode #11 - Resource Development

November 13, 2025

Season 2, Episode #11 - Resource Development

Chapter 19 of Accelerating Revenue covers an essential component of Enablement: Resource Development. The real hero in the GTM resource library is often a playbook, but revenue generating teams also need things like call outlines, objection handling, competitive positioning, email templates, use cases, customer stories, and case studies. In this episode, our Notebook LM hosts “Lucas & Maren” cover how Enablement gets the right resources to the revenue teams at the right time, plus strategies to keep resources and knowledge up to date, ensure they are actionable, and stay on top of new resource development.

Episode thumbnail for GTM Kickoff

October 30, 2025

GTM Kickoff

Chapter 18 of Accelerating Revenue covers one of our favorite topics: GTM Kickoff. This event is one of the highest-profile initiatives Enablement leads each year, and typically the biggest investment the company makes in their GTM teams. In this episode, our Notebook LM hosts “Lucas & Maren” discuss important considerations that go into producing an impactful event. They cover a range of things such as planning for in person or remote, focus and alignment, balance of education, celebration, fun, and team building, incorporating the customer perspective, the importance of rehearsals, and more.
